    Two things - Kenya is also known as the land of contrasts because you can find every climatic condition in Kenya. Tourism is big in Kenya and what we now know as "Safari" was born in Kenya. Secondly - Chama is a special mary-go-round. You come together in a group and draw lots so that you know the order of the sharing from the first to the last. You (each person) then make a monthly contribution of an agreed amount which is all given to the first person, then the next person in month two, and so on. Once every person has had a turn, you draw lots again and start a fresh round. Lastly - Mpesa was born in Kenya and the rest of the world copied and has been trying to catch up with Kenya as far as that is concerned.
